Small Kitchen Diner Interior Design

Small spaces can be a challenge when it comes to interior design, but with the right approach, even the tiniest kitchen diners can be transformed into functional and stylish areas. One popular design option for small kitchen diners is to use light colors and minimalistic furniture to create a sense of space. Utilizing clever storage solutions and multi-functional furniture can also help maximize the limited space available.

Open Plan Kitchen Diner Interior Design

The open plan kitchen diner is a popular choice for those who want a seamless flow between their kitchen and dining area. This design often involves removing walls to create one unified space, which can make a smaller home feel more spacious. When designing an open plan kitchen diner, it's important to consider how the two areas will blend together and ensure a cohesive design throughout.

The Role of Lighting, Color, and Materials

interior design kitchen diner Lighting is a crucial element in any interior design, especially in a kitchen diner. It not only serves a practical purpose but also creates a mood and ambiance. Natural light is ideal, so if possible, incorporate large windows or skylights into the design. For artificial lighting, consider a combination of overhead lights and task lighting, such as under-cabinet lights for food preparation areas. Color is another essential aspect of interior design that can greatly impact the look and feel of a kitchen diner. Neutral colors like white, beige, and gray are popular choices for a timeless and versatile look. However, adding pops of color through accents and accessories can add personality and warmth to the space. Materials used in the kitchen diner should be both functional and aesthetically pleasing. For example, durable and easy-to-clean materials like granite or quartz are great options for countertops, while hardwood or tile floors can withstand heavy foot traffic. Consider incorporating natural materials like wood, stone, or metal for a touch of warmth and texture in the design.
